Entry Level Mechanical Engineer

Mechanical Design Engineer will be responsible for the concept and development of mechanical components and systems that may include multiple plastic processes, castings or forgings, stampings, laser cut parts, and welding or bonding of components.

Responsibilities

  • Communication with suppliers and customers on product selection and integration
  • Use of Creo and Windchill to support 3-D Modeling of components, sheet metal and possibly hydraulic or electrical routings.
  • Creation and support of 2D drawings and specification documentation
  • Work with manufacturing, product verification and validation, and suppliers to develop efficient and cost effective designs
  • Compile and furnish necessary information (engineering decisions and reports of pertinent design analyses data) to document the design solution required for building of prototypes and adoption of the design with possible involvement of other functional engineers.

Requirements

  • Bachelor's of Science in Mechanical, Aerospace, or Agricultural Engineering or related degree
  • Strong mechanical aptitude demonstrated through work experience or hobbies
  • Excellent communication both written and verbal
  • Demonstrated ability to meet deadlines and commitments
  • Strong analytical, problem solving and troubleshooting skills
  • Ability to thrive in a team environment

Desired Attributes

  • Experience in 3-D Modeling Software; Creo experience (Preferred)
  • Previous experience with Windchill or PDMLink
  • Strong understanding of GD&T
  • Design experience or exposure to off-road mobile equipment
  • Ability to address quality issues, determine root cause and drive to a corrective action
  • Desire to work in an engineering environment focusing on robust & cost effective designs

About RFA Engineering

RFA Engineering has provided product development and engineering services to industry leading customers since 1943. Our primary focus is the development of off highway equipment including agricultural, construction, mining, recreational, industrial, and special machines. Our work includes concept development, product design, documentation, problem-solving, simulation, optimization, and testing of components, systems and complete machines. Our engineering staff is located at our Engineering Center in Minneapolis, branch office in Dubuque, IA, and at numerous customer sites throughout the U.S.
